Pre-Production Planning

While you don't have to hire a video production company during pre-production, they can often help you with the planning stages of production for your TV show or film. You might not realize how much is involved in the pre-production stage especially if this is your first film or show.

The pre-production stage is where you will iron out any issues with your script, cast your actors and background performers, hire your filming crew, and work out your budget to ensure you have funds for not only the filming process but post-production too.

A video production company that offers pre-production services can help you find locations and help you obtain permits to shoot in those locations. They can give you valuable advice and expertise to ensure your project is ready for the production stage.

The Filming Process

A video production company is key during the filming process to ensure what you envisioned for your project can be achieved. They can help you set up rehearsals with your actors and background performers, set up lighting and sound rigs to ensure the right atmosphere, and work with camera operators to get the best shots possible.

A video production company has the expertise to help you decide on what type of shots will work best for each scene. It's always best to have multiple camera angles on any given scene to give the editors more to work with. What you had originally thought of for the scene might work better at a different angle once you see it on the screen.

A video production company can help keep you on schedule while filming as well. New filmmakers may go over budget because they might work too much on one scene instead of focusing on the overall picture. Professionals can help keep you focused and on task.

Post-Production Work

A definite added bonus to hiring a video production company for your business is, they can help you through the post-production work.

Post-production involves putting the entire project together including editing what was filmed, sound editing and mixing and adding sound effects if needed, special effects added to any shot footage if needed, and more.
